Transaction 89ad22ac5106ac5d9351207c36c905c7ed0ee37d785dc33f25f8826f5e97cb24
1 Input
1 Output
-
89ad22ac5106ac5d9351207c36c905c7ed0ee37d785dc33f25f8826f5e97cb24:0
- value
- 123589728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c740c14d504144f1fe209b3aa560d7937826c29 OP_EQUAL
- address
- 3EVfYVyMr3y31DdVCZE3iPX7CD4B1MtDLx